Nikos Kokolakis: Trails

Trails embodies a site-related sonic installation, drawing inspiration from the historical significance of the Decauville route in Florina, Greece. Amidst the enduring stone remnants of this structure, frozen in time, an immersive soundscape unfolds, weaving tales that resonate from both the past and the future. As the haunting echoes fill the space, a lone bell tolls from the collar of a wandering dog, prompting contemplation on the enigmatic figure it anticipates, evoking the essence of an awaited Ulysses.

  • Composer(s) Vassilis Kitsos, Anastassis Philipakopoulos, Nikos Kokolakis, Dimitris Bakas, Maria Gouvali, Glyka Koutoula, Alexandros Chatzitimotheou
